Facilities ticket — Night shift, Brindlecote Campus. Twenty-two interns from the Fennhollow programme arrive tomorrow at 08:00. Please unlock seminar rooms B2 and B3 by 06:30, set chairs to classroom layout, and confirm the water coolers on level one are refilled. Leave the loading bay clear for their equipment van. Overnight access to the prep corridor requires the pass code below.

badge for bajop-yawep: bdg-NNHEW-6

**Q: How do I adjust relevance weights in Quillstone Search?**

Edit the boost values in the tuning config, then run the offline evaluation suite before deploying. Never push weight changes on Fridays. If the tuning console locks you out after three failed attempts, you'll need the recovery passphrase to regain access. It is:

unlock words, hahip-baduf: holwyn-istath-julvan

Ticket: Staging env misconfigured for Siftgate bloom filter

The bloom layer in front of the Pellet KV store is rejecting all lookups in staging because the env file was copied from the dev template without credentials. False-positive tuning values are fine; only the auth line is missing. To unblock the weekly demo, the Pellet admission secret must be set on the following line.

env line for yaguf-fajop: LEDGER_TOKEN13=fb08984397349